合适的添加索引会加快数据库查询速度,过多就会适得其反,那么使用索引要注意哪些问题呢
在使用索引的同时,还应该了解MySQL 中索引存在的限制,以便在索引应用中尽可能地避开限制所带来的问题。下面列出了目前 MySQL 中与索引使用相关的限制。
1) MyISAM存储引擎索引键长度的总和不能超过1000字节;
...
VARCHAR是一种比CHAR更加灵活的
,同样用于表示
数据,但是VARCHAR可以保存可变长度的字符串。其中M代表该
所允许保存的字符串的最大长度,只要长度小于该最大值的字符串都可以被保存在该数据类型中。因此,对于那些难以估计确切长度的
来说,使用VARCHAR
更加明智。VARCHAR
所支持的最大长度也是255个
。...
我们浏览一些新闻网站经常会看到本周信息排行,上周信息排行等。那么这是怎么实现的呢,原理几是运用mysql里面的日期函数进行处理,具体操作如下
mysql查询今天,昨天,近7天,近30天,本月,上一月数据的方法分析总结:
比如有一文章表article,存储文章的添加文章的时间是add_time字段,该字段为int(5)类型...
网站打开速度慢的原因跟多,图片太大,代码没有格式化等等,今天从mysql方面查找原因
针对MySQL数据库服务器查询逐渐变慢的问题, 进行分析,并提出相应的解决办法,具体的分析解决办法如下:
会经常发现开发人员查一下没用索引的语句或者没有limit n的语句,这些没语句会对数据库造成很大的影响...
日志经常不整理时间长了是很占用服务器空间的,那么日志文件在哪,请看下文 在mysql中二进制日志都是以mysql-bin.0000XX为例子,后跟相关的数字了,他们每过一段时间会生成一个文件,这样如果不定期清理你会发现文件把磁盘空间全占了,那么我们要如何来解决此问题呢?
这是数据库的操作日志,例如UPDATE一个表,或...
我们一般在实现网站分页的时候这样limit 0,10 limit 10,10那么怎么使用它优化加快速度呢 limit优化我们分享了非常多的方法,但是看到文章操作方法都一相,下面我介绍的主要是子查询优化方法了,希望例子对各位有帮助.
最近做的一个网站谷歌站长工具提示sitemap访问超时,这是为毛原因呢?之前不是好好的么...
mysql怎么要获取随机阅读,在php里面有rand()函数,那么在mysql里面有没呢?那么请看下文 在php里面的函数跟msql不一样 ,在php里面rand(1,10)但是在mysql里面就不是这样了
mysql如何随机抽取数据库里的几条数据呢?读取随机数只要使用RAND就可以了,方法非常的简单,下面我来给各位举个例子.
数据库连接这些就...
有时候在使用mysql的时候发现把数据delete了但是表所占的空间大小没变,那怎么办呢 记得在很中学时学计算机时老师就告诉我delete删除记录只是给数据库中的记录加一个删除标识了,这样数据库空间并不是减少了,当时没想这么多,昨天发现一个数据库利用delete 删除之后容量没变,后来百度了一下发现了下面...
有时候看到别人文章随机阅读,他是怎么实现的呢,这里可以用的rand函数 随机读取数据:
MYSQL自身语句便可实现,下面举例来说明,比如,我要随机读取6条数据显示给浏览者.
MYSQL语句,代码如下:select * from youtable order by rand() limit 6";
如果要随机取6-10条记录,可以这样:
$num=rand()(5,10);$sql="selec...
MYSQL启用日志 [root@jianshe99]# whereis my.ini [root@jianshe99]# vi /etc/my.cnf [mysqld] datadir=/var/lib/mysql socket=/var/lib/mysql/mysql.sock user=mysql # Default to using old password format for compatibility with mysql 3.x # clients (those using the mysqlclient10 compatibility pack...